No. 2 Indians cruise to tourney win

The second-ranked Marion volleyball team won its own Marion Invitational on Saturday at Marion, avenging a loss earlier in the day to Grundy Center 25-12, 25-13 in the final. Xavier also competed.

In pool play, the Indians beat Cascade 21-19, 21-8 and North Linn 21-12, 21-9 before losing to Grundy Center 21-19, 11-21, 15-9.

Marion beat Union 25-21, 25-18 in the semifinals before winning the rematch with Grundy Center in the final.

The Saints beat Durant 21-13, 21-12 and Benton 21-11, 21-15 before losing to Union 16-21, 21-17, 15-10 in pool play. Xavier lost to Grundy Center 25-15, 25-16 in the semifinals.

Prairie jumps to 3rd in volleyball

The Prairie Hawks zoomed seven spots from No. 10 to No. 3 in the new Class 5A volleyball rankings Thursday by the IGHSAU.

Prairie (11-1) won all six of its matches at the Linn-Mar Invitational on Saturday, including four victories over ranked teams. The Hawks returned to Linn-Mar on Tuesday night and beat the Lions again.

Kennedy fell one spot to No. 5 in Class 5A. The Cougars (12-5) knocked off then-No. 1 Cedar Falls on Tuesday night, but the Cougars lost two matches to Cedar Falls at the Osage Tournament on Saturday. Cedar Falls dropped to No. 4 in the poll.

Linn-Mar (12-4) fell two spots to No. 9 this week after its losses to Prairie.

Bettendorf (11-1) is ranked No. 1 in Class 5A. Its only loss was to Prairie in the MVC/MAC Challenge earlier in the season.

The Marion Indians (10-2) stayed No. 2 in Class 4A. West Delaware leads the 4A rankings.

No. 2 Marion rolls by Benton Bobcats

VAN HORNE - The second-ranked Marion volleyball team used a balanced attack to sweep Benton Community, 25-15, 25-10, 25-12, in a Wamac Conference match Tuesday night in Van Horne.

Caitlyn Smith collected 39 assists and two blocks for Marion. Isabella Sade finished with 13 kills, five aces and three blocks. Kaela Halvorson contributed nine kills and six digs.

Olivia Frazier had nine kills for the Indians. Alyssa Thomas had seven kills and seven digs. Morgan Swanger had six kills, six digs and two blocks. Kenzie Redmond provided seven digs.

Marion raised its records to 10-2 overall and 3-0 in the conference.

Cougars jump to 4th in volleyball poll

The Kennedy Cougars climbed three spots to No. 4 in the new Class 5A volleyball rankings Thursday by the IGHSAU.

Kennedy has an 8-3 record and trails Cedar Falls, Bettendorf and Ankeny Centennial in the poll.

Linn-Mar jumped one notch to No. 7 in the 5A rankings. Prairie fell five spots to No. 10.

The Marion Indians stayed No. 2 in Class 4A behind West Delaware.

No. 2 Indians down Center Point

The Marion High School volleyball survived a blip in the fourth set Tuesday night and defeated Center Point-Urbana, 25-15, 25-15, 18-25, 25-15, in a Wamac Conference match.

Marion, which is ranked No. 2 in Class 4A, raised its records to 5-1 overall and 2-0 in the league.

Haley Dullea collected 21 digs for the Indians and was 17-for-17 on her serves with three aces. Caitlyn Smith finished with 35 assists. Morgan Swanger had 20 digs, went 20-for-20 on serves and had eight kills.

Alyssa Thomas contributed 15 digs, nine kills, three blocks and was 18-for-18 on serves with two aces. Kaela Halvorson had 16 digs and nine kills. Isabella Sade provided 12 kills and five blocks. Olivia Frazier had six kills.
